Get started4 Williamson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Peterborough (PE3 6BA). It has a recorded floor area of 83 m² (around 893 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(November 2023) shows a C (score 73). When first surveyed in March 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84).
On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. Today's modelled estimate of £212,000 sits 76.7% above the 2011 sale of £120,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£134/sq ft) was about 26.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2021.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last changed hands 15 years ago, in August 2011.
